Course details

Principles of Plant Propagation — Understanding the basic concepts and methods of plant propagation, including sexual and asexual reproduction, and the benefits and limitations of each method.
Plant Biology and Physiology — Exploring the structure and function of plants, including cellular processes, photosynthesis, and plant hormones, to provide a foundation for understanding plant propagation.
Propagation Techniques — Learning the specific techniques for propagating different types of plants, including seed propagation, cuttings, layering, grafting, and division.
Plant Nursery Management — Understanding the principles of managing a plant nursery, including site selection, soil preparation, irrigation, fertilization, pest and disease management, and record keeping.
Plant Identification and Selection — Identifying and selecting appropriate plants for propagation, taking into account factors such as climate, soil conditions, and market demand.
Business Planning and Management — Developing a business plan for a plant propagation business, including market analysis, financial projections, and operational planning.
Marketing and Sales — Learning strategies for marketing and selling plants, including pricing, packaging, and distribution, as well as creating a brand and building customer relationships.
Sustainable Practices in Plant Propagation — Exploring sustainable practices in plant propagation, including the use of renewable resources, reducing waste, and promoting biodiversity.
Regulations and Compliance — Understanding the regulations and compliance requirements for a plant propagation business, including plant health and safety, environmental regulations, and import/export requirements.
